Across TCGA patient cohorts, SIRT4 protein abundance is significantly associated with the protein abundance of many other proteins, with 433 significant associations in total. CCRCC shows the largest number of these associations.

The most reproducible SIRT4-associated proteins across cancer lineages are PTPRS, RNPC3_S108, and ASPN. Each is linked with SIRT4 in more than 1 cancer types. Because this analysis shows association rather than direction, both SIRT4-to-partner and partner-to-SIRT4 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, SIRT4 versus PTPRS in CCRCC, with a Pearson correlation of 0.79.
